Patak Meat Products Inc
If you want to taste authentic German, Polish, Czech and other European meat products, along with pickles, herring, pumpernickel, etc., then a trip to the Patak Store in Austell, Georgia, is well worth your time. Even the sales staff has an old country charm. Great for stocking up at Christmas time and other festive occasions. Enjoy the Schnitzel and Weisswurst.

The Atlantic Times
The Atlantic Times is provided free of charge to readers interested in German-American news, history and culture. It is published monthly. Their Executive Editor Theo Sommer used to work for the German weekly "Die Zeit". His selection and editing of interesting articles about business, politics and cultural events in Germany and their impact on German-American relations is excellent.It is a pleasure to read this monthly paper.
